Why You Need a Camping Water Purifier

Access to safe drinking water is crucial when camping. Water sources in the wild can be contaminated with bacteria, viruses, protozoa, and chemicals. Without proper filtration, drinking untreated water can lead to serious health risks such as diarrhea, giardia, and dysentery. That’s where camping water purifiers come in—they remove harmful pathogens, ensuring you have safe water to drink, cook, and clean with.


Factors to Consider When Choosing a Camping Water Purifier

  1. Filtration Technology
    Different water purifiers use various technologies such as activated carbon, UV light, and mechanical filtration. Each has its own strengths and weaknesses. For example:

    • Carbon filters are great for improving taste and removing chemicals.
    • UV purifiers use ultraviolet light to kill pathogens.
    • Pump filters or gravity filters are ideal for purifying large quantities of water quickly.
  2. Portability and Weight
    When choosing a portable water purifier for camping, weight is a critical factor. You want a purifier that’s easy to carry in your backpack without adding unnecessary bulk. For shorter trips, compact filters may be sufficient, but for extended hikes or backpacking, consider a larger, more durable purifier that can handle larger amounts of water.
  3. Ease of Use
    Look for a water purifier that’s simple to use, especially if you’re new to camping. A quick setup and easy maintenance can save you time and hassle when you’re out in the wild.
  4. Capacity and Flow Rate
    If you’re traveling in a group, you’ll need a water purifier with a larger capacity and faster flow rate to keep up with demand. Consider how many people will be relying on the purifier and choose accordingly.
  5. Durability and Longevity
    Your camping water purifier should be built to withstand the harsh outdoor environment. Look for products that are designed to be durable and have replaceable filters to ensure long-term use.

Top Camping Water Purifiers on the Market

  1. LifeStraw Personal Water Filter
    The LifeStraw is one of the most popular and trusted camping water purifiers. It’s compact, lightweight, and effective in filtering out bacteria, protozoa, and other harmful pathogens. It’s an excellent option for solo campers or light hikers.
  2. Sawyer Mini Water Filtration System
    Another highly rated portable water purifier, the Sawyer Mini is small, affordable, and capable of filtering up to 100,000 gallons of water. It’s perfect for backpacking and survival situations.
  3. Platypus GravityWorks Water Filter System
    Ideal for larger groups, the Platypus GravityWorks uses gravity to filter water, which means less manual effort. It’s fast and highly efficient, able to filter up to 4 liters of water in just a few minutes.
  4. Katadyn Hiker Pro Water Filter
    Known for its excellent filtration capabilities, the Katadyn Hiker Pro is a lightweight, efficient choice for hikers. It’s easy to use and removes bacteria, protozoa, and other contaminants with a quick flow rate.

How to Use a Camping Water Purifier

Using a camping water purifier is generally straightforward. Here’s a step-by-step guide for most portable water filters:

  1. Collect Water: Gather water from a natural source like a stream or lake. Make sure to avoid water that’s visibly polluted or near a campfire site.
  2. Set Up the Purifier: Depending on the type of purifier, you may need to pump, squeeze, or hang the filter to let gravity do its work.
  3. Filter the Water: Run the water through the filter system. This may take anywhere from a few seconds to several minutes, depending on the purifier type and water volume.
  4. Enjoy: Once the water is filtered, it’s ready for drinking or cooking.
